UNIVERSIDAD POLITECNICA DE TULANCINGO
“PRACTICA RASPBERRY PI PICO “
MÓDULO DE VIBRACIÓN
Por
CARLOS ORTIZ LIRA
Carrera:
INGENERIA ROBOTICA
U Asignatura:
PROGRAMACIÓN DE SISTEMAS EMBEBIDOS
Nombre del Catedrático:
P
DR. CESAR JOEL CAMACHO BELLO
Séptimo cuatrimestre
Grupo IR71
T SEPTIEMBRE – DICIEMBRE 2022
Tulancingo de Bravo, Hidalgo a 26 de Septiembre del 2022
INTRODUCCIÓN
En esta práctica practicaremos con un microcontrolador (RASPBEERY PI PICO) el cual es
un componente electrónico con grandes beneficios, con un microcontrolador tenemos la
posibilidad de realizar múltiples tareas, tales como la administración de entrada y salida en
un proceso informático determinado. En el sector industrial es frecuente ver su aplicación
en controladores y otros sistemas de automatización que detallaremos más adelante.
OBJETIVO:
El objetivo de esa práctica es poder poner en práctica nuestros conocimientos adquiridos en
Thonny Python el cual estuvimos trabajando la semana pasada por lo que al conectar un
microcontrolador el poder hacer la comunicación entre el programa y el microcontrolador
y familiarizarse con este componente, además de usar el módulo de vibraciones.
DESCRIPCIÓN:
El módulo de vibraciones es un dispositivo que causa efecto vibratorio cuando la entrada de
PWM es alta. Funciona en un rango de voltaje 3V a 5.3V DC, siendo un motor de corriente
continua.
MARCO TEORICO
¿Qué es la Raspberry Pi Pico?
La Raspberry Pi Pico es una placa con microcontrolador creada por la fundación Raspberry
Pi. Está diseñada para ser de bajo coste y al mismo tiempo incluir un conjunto razonable de
entradas y salidas para el procesador RP2040 , del que hablo más abajo. Además del
procesador incluye 2 MB de memoria Flash (OJO 2 megas no gigas ni nada de eso, lo que
ocupa una foto normalita de un móvil de hace unos años) y un chip para gestión de la
alimentación que admite tensiones de entrada de 1,8 a 5,5 V. Esto permite alimentar la
Raspberry Pi Pico desde distintos tipos de fuentes de alimentación, desde el clásico
cargador microUSB a 5,5V pasando por combinar dos o tres pilas AA en serie.
Sobre la Raspberry Pi Pico
¿Qué es MicroPython?
De acuerdo a la definición del sitio oficial, MicroPython es un pequeño pero eficiente
interprete del Lenguaje de Programación Python 3 que incluye un subconjunto mínimo de
librerías y que además está optimizado para que pueda correr en microcontroladores y
ambientes restringidos.
Con MicroPython tienes la posibilidad de escribir códigos más simples, en lugar de usar
Lenguajes de Programación de más bajo nivel como C o C++, que es el que utiliza Arduino
por ejemplo.
¿Qué es el módulo de vibración?
El Módulo de Vibración PWM es un dispositivo que causara efecto vibratorio cuando la
entrada de PWM es alta, similar al que un teléfono celular estando en modo
vibración/silencioso. Funciona en un rango de voltaje 3V a 5.3 V DC, siendo un motor de
corriente continua.
¿Para qué sirve?
El Módulo de Vibración PWM es adecuado para la producción de productos interactivos
sensibles a la vibración, es un pequeño motor de vibración adecuado como indicador no
audible. Ideal para proyectos de DIY (Do It Yourself-Hazlo Tú Mismo).Compatible con
tarjetas de desarrollo Arduino, Raspberry, ESP.
DESARROLLO
Abrimos Thonny Micro Python
Creamos un nuevo fichero
Creamos un programa para poder visualizar la comunicación entre el programa y el Raspberry pi
pico.
Para hacer la comunicación con la Raspberry pi pico entramos en el apartado de ejecutar y
dar clic en configuración interprete.
Seleccionamos la MicroPython (Raspberry Pi Pico) para poder hacer la comunicación, después
seleccionamos la parte inferior izquierda (Install our update MicroPython).
Conectamos al puerto USB a la Raspberry Pi Pico pulsando el botón de Reset para poder
establecer la comunicación entre ellos.
Una vez que se hayan descargado los datos y que se haya inicializado el primer programa para la
comprobación de la comunicación podemos hacer el siguiente programa de comprobación.
Ahora se hará una conexión físicamente para poder inicializar el programa y muestre los
resultados.
Materiales:
Una Protoboard
Una Raspberry pi pico
Cable para transferencia de datos V8
Un Led de 1.4 vc
Jumper de colores
Una laptop
El programa de Thonny Python
Un módulo de vibración
PROGRAMA
CONEXIONES
CONCLUSIÓN
En esta práctica pude aprender más sobre lo que es la electrónica y la programación en ello
el aprender a programar en MicroPython y conocer la Raspberry Pi Pico y más comandos
de códigos que me ayudan a saber a programar un poco más, y pues el observar el módulo
de vibración accionado por el programa lo cual fue algo increíble.